A questionable leak has revealed what appears to be a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ra dummy unit in a vibrant orange color scheme, sparking immediate backlash online. The saturated orange hue bears striking resemblance to Apple’s iPhone 17 Pro Cosmic Orange, leading many to accuse Samsung of copying its rival.
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ra Orange Leak: What We Know
The leak originated from a Reddit user who posted composite images showing alleged Galaxy S26 Ultra dummy units. However, the source’s credibility remains highly questionable, with leaker Steve ‘OnLeaks’ Hemmerstoffer suggesting the image may be AI-generated.

Community Backlash: “Originality is Dead”
The orange color option received overwhelmingly negative reactions on Reddit. Users criticized the shade as unoriginal, with comments like “Almost every huge phone company is trying to be like Apple, originality is dead” and “Why does Samsung want to be Apple so bad?”
The backlash stems from the timing—Apple recently launched its iPhone 17 Pro series with a distinctive Cosmic Orange colorway, making Samsung’s alleged choice appear derivative rather than innovative.
Samsung’s Orange Color History
Samsung previously offered orange Galaxy S24 series models as online-exclusive options, but with a more subtle, muted hue. The alleged S26 Ultra dummy shows an extremely vibrant orange that closely matches Apple’s aggressive saturation level, fueling copycat accusations.
This isn’t Samsung’s first controversy over Apple similarities. The company faced criticism when it released the Galaxy Watch Ultra, which bore striking resemblance to the Apple Watch Ultra.

Should You Believe This Leak?
Probably not. The leak lacks credible sourcing, has possible AI generation concerns, and comes from an unverified Redditor. Even if legitimate dummy units exist, manufacturers often test multiple color options that never reach production.
Samsung has historically offered diverse color palettes, and a final S26 Ultra lineup could include completely different options. The Galaxy S26 Ultra is expected to launch in early 2026, giving Samsung plenty of time to finalize its color strategy.
